Aug 27, 2023 · Boric acid causes the roaches in your home to starve. Dust a thin layer of the boric acid powder into the cracks around cabinets and baseboards. Leave the boric acid for about 1 week before vacuuming it up and replacing it. [13] To attract more roaches to the boric acid, mix in 1 part powdered sugar or flour. White vinegar is often recommended as a natural way to get rid of roaches. Unfortunately, it doesn’t actually kill these problem insects. It’s more of a cleaning tool than anything else, and it won’t actually help eliminate your roach problem. It can, however, help deter roaches and get rid of germs in the kitchen when used as a cleaning ...

Expert Advice On Improving Your Home Videos Latest View All Guides Latest View ...Unfortunately, baking soda alone does not kill roaches instantly. While it may have some effect on the critters, it is not a reliable method for eradicating a roach infestation. Baking soda can only act as a deterrent or an additional tool in a more comprehensive approach to pest control.
